i'm guessing you mean kilkee in clare? word has it the fishing in the area is very poor of late. check out the report by donagh in the shore angling section on poulnasherry, that's about 5 miles outside kilkee on the shannon estuary. since the fishing has been so sketchy on the estuary lately, your best bet would be cappagh pier in kilrush town, you pass through kilrush on your way to kilkee, it's about 10 miles before you reach kilkee. you should pick up dogs, the odd strap, and the odd thorny.
if you wanna head the open atlantic, then head north out of kilkee for a few miles and you'll hit doughmore beach, i have no idea how it'll fish at this time of year but that's where the current irish record bass came from.
the fishing in the area really can be hit or miss at this time of year. throw a spinning rod in the car too, and messing around on the rocks in kilkee bay could easily through up a few smallish pollack. failing that, bring a fly rod and head for the reservoir stocked with brownies!!
